The Stark Reality: Hungary’s Shrinking Population
Hungary is grappling with a significant demographic challenge, primarily driven by persistently low birth rates. This issue isn’t new; it’s a trend that has been developing over several decades, placing considerable strain on the nation’s social and economic structures. The current fertility rate in Hungary is below the replacement level, meaning that the population is not producing enough children to maintain its size naturally. This decline has far-reaching implications, affecting everything from the labor force to pension systems.
Government Intervention: A Pro-Natal Approach
in response to this demographic crisis, the Hungarian government, led by Prime Minister Viktor Orbán, has implemented a series of pro-natal policies aimed at encouraging couples to have more children.These policies include financial incentives,such as:
- subsidized loans for young families
- tax breaks for families with multiple children
- Direct financial support for childcare
these measures are designed to alleviate the financial burden associated with raising children,making it more appealing for couples to expand their families. the government hopes that by reducing the economic disincentives to having children,they can boost the country’s birth rate.
Analyzing the Effectiveness: Are Pro-Natal Policies working?
The effectiveness of these pro-natal policies is a subject of ongoing debate. While there has been some increase in birth rates since the implementation of these measures, it is challenging to determine whether this is a direct result of the policies or due to other factors. Some experts argue that financial incentives alone are not enough to address the complex reasons behind declining birth rates.Factors such as career aspirations, access to education, and changing societal norms also play a significant role.
While financial incentives can provide some relief, they don’t address the underlying cultural and societal shifts that influence decisions about family size.Dr.Agnes Kovacs, Demography Expert

Norway’s Housing Market Defies Expectations with Continued price Growth
Despite economic headwinds, the Norwegian housing market demonstrates surprising resilience, with prices continuing to climb.
Unexpected Surge in Property Values
Contrary to predictions of a slowdown,Norway’s housing market is experiencing an upswing. Recent data indicates a steady increase in property values across the country, challenging earlier forecasts of stagnation or decline. This unexpected growth has caught the attention of economists and potential homebuyers alike.
Factors Fueling the housing Market Boom
Several factors contribute to this unexpected resilience. Low interest rates, while subject to change, have made mortgages more accessible, driving demand.Additionally,a growing population in major urban centers like Oslo and Bergen is intensifying competition for available properties. Furthermore, the strong Norwegian economy, bolstered by its oil and gas sector, provides a sense of financial security that encourages investment in real estate.
Consider the current economic landscape: While global markets face uncertainty, norway’s robust sovereign wealth fund and prudent fiscal policies offer a buffer against economic shocks.This stability translates into greater consumer confidence and a willingness to invest in long-term assets like homes.
Regional Variations in Price Growth
While the national trend points towards rising prices, regional variations exist. Major cities like Oslo continue to lead the way in terms of price appreciation, driven by high demand and limited supply. However, smaller towns and rural areas are also experiencing growth, albeit at a slower pace. This suggests a broader trend of increased interest in property ownership across the country.

Netanyahu to Meet Trump Amidst Trade Tensions and Geopolitical Concerns
By Archnetys News Team
Sudden White House Visit Planned Amidst Rising Trade Disputes
In a move that has surprised many, Israeli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u is reportedly scheduled to visit the White House as early as Monday. This unexpected meeting comes at a critical juncture, with trade relations between the U.S. and Israel strained by recent tariff impositions.
The impetus for this urgent summit appears to be the recent implementation of a 17% tariff on Israeli goods by the Trump administration. Despite Israel’s attempts to preemptively avoid these tariffs by eliminating customs duties on american products, the U.S. proceeded with the levy, signaling a potential shift in economic policy towards one of its key allies.
Trump called Netanyahu on Thursday while the Israeli prime minister was visiting Hungary. During the conversation, Trump proposed a meeting in the White House to discuss the tariff rates, without putting a specific date.
The call, initiated by President Trump while Netanyahu was in Hungary, led to the impromptu scheduling of this high-stakes meeting. The conversation reportedly centered on the newly imposed tariffs, with Trump extending an invitation to discuss the matter further in person.
Beyond trade: A Broader Agenda on the Table
While trade tensions are undoubtedly a primary driver for the meeting, sources indicate that the discussions will extend to other pressing geopolitical issues. The ongoing Iran crisis and the conflict in Gaza are also expected to be key topics of conversation between the two leaders.
The meeting occurs against a backdrop of increasing instability in the Middle East. the Iran nuclear program remains a source of international concern, with recent reports suggesting advancements beyond agreed-upon limitations. Concurrently, the situation in Gaza continues to be volatile, with intermittent escalations of violence and a persistent humanitarian crisis.
According to the sources,Netanyahu and trump will also discuss the Iran crisis and the war in gaza.
